When Was This Big House Built?
This building is pretty old! Construction started way back in 1836. That's even before your grandparents were born, and maybe even your great-grandparents! It took a long time to build, with lots of workers and careful planning. It's made of strong stone, which is why it's still standing tall today, looking just as grand as it did when it was new.

A Star on the Ten-Dollar Bill!
Here's a super fun fact: the Treasury Building is so famous, its picture is printed on the back of the United States ten-dollar bill! So, next time you see a ten-dollar bill, you can look closely and spot this incredible building. It's a reminder of where the money comes from and the important work that happens inside.
